In remembrance

Today I paused to think about that fateful day 9 years ago. I remember missing school that day because I was sick. I woke up at around 8:45 and came upstairs. Soon afterwards I heard my mom from the other room yelling that she couldn't believe what was happening on the screen. I rushed in and looked I saw smoke billowing from a tower. My mom told me it was in New York. We watched the story develop and we saw when the towers crashed down. I think I felt numbness. My heart was lifted by the amount of love that was poured out to the people of the east coast.

Perhaps I was too young to really understand that day. I was just eleven years old; but I will always remember the love that I felt and saw from that tragic experience. May we remember the bond we all felt in the days and weeks and even months after the attack.
